Understanding Twitter Moments

Twitter Moments are essentially compilations of tweets organized around particular events, themes, or narratives. Initially launched as a feature to allow users to create storylines from breaking news or significant events, Twitter Moments has since evolved into a versatile tool that marketers, journalists, and various other content creators can utilize to share curated experiences.

Each Moment can include:

  • Tweets from various users, including your own.
  • Media assets such as photos and videos related to the topic.
  • Custom Commentary to provide context or additional insights into the information being shared.

Twitter Moments helps create a centralized space for followers to find relevant content quickly and allows curators to tell a compelling story through the aggregation of tweets and media.

How to Create Twitter Moments

Creating a Twitter Moment is straightforward. Here’s a step-by-step guide:

1. Access Twitter Moments

  • Log in to your Twitter account.
  • On the left sidebar, click on the “More” option, and then select “Moments.”

2. Start a New Moment

  • Click the “Create new Moment” button.
  • A new window will open where you can start assembling your Moment.

3. Add Title and Description

  • Title: Choose a descriptive title that captures the essence of your Moment. This title should be engaging and informative to encourage viewers to explore further.
  • Description: A brief description outlining what the Moment is about can entice your followers and provide context.

4. Curate Content

  • Add Tweets: You can search for tweets using keywords, hashtags, or directly from your own account. Click on the tweets you want to include, and they will be added to your Moment timeline.
  • Include Media: You can upload images and videos relevant to the Moment or use tweets that already contain media.
  • Rearrange Content: Once you’ve added tweets and media, you can rearrange them to tell your story effectively.

5. Add Commentary

  • Providing your insights or context can enhance your Moment’s storytelling. Click on “Add a tweet” to include your commentary in between tweets or as a standalone thought.

6. Publish Your Moment

  • Once you’re satisfied with the content and layout, click on the “Publish” button.
  • After publishing, you’ll receive a unique URL that you can share directly with your followers or embed in other platforms.

How to Share Twitter Moments

Once your Moment is live, you can share it in various ways:

  • Directly on Twitter: Tweet out the link to your Moment, encouraging followers to check it out. Consider using relevant hashtags to enhance visibility.
  • Embed Link: You can embed the Moment link on your website, blog, or newsletter for broader reach.
  • Promote Across Platforms: Share the Moment on other social media platforms like Facebook, Instagram, or LinkedIn to draw your audience’s attention.

Strategies for Curating and Sharing Relevant Content

Now that you understand how to create and share Twitter Moments, let’s explore effective strategies for curating and sharing relevant content with your followers.

1. Focus on Timeliness

  • Twitter Moments are perfect for capturing current events, trends, or timely discussions. Always stay updated with trending topics and identify opportunities to create Moments around them.
  • News Coverage: If something significant happens in your industry, create a Moment that aggregates tweets from relevant sources, including your insights.

2. Highlight User-Generated Content

  • If your brand or personal account receives mentions or tweets featuring user-generated content, curate these tweets into a Moment. This approach not only displays customer engagement but also builds community and trust.
  • Encourage followers to tag your handle or use a specific hashtag for their content so you can easily find them.

3. Educational or Thematic Series

  • Create Moments that highlight educational content, tutorials, how-tos, or thematic discussions. If you run a business that offers various services, create Moments that delve into each service in detail—showing tweets and visuals of those services in action.
  • For example, if you’re a fitness coach, compile tweets and tips into a Month of Health or Wellness Journey Moment.

4. Engagement and Events

  • For events like webinars, conferences, or product launches, consider creating a Moment that shares real-time updates, photos, and participant tweets.
  • After the event, compile highlights into a Moment that followers can revisit, showcasing key insights and memories that built the event’s successful narrative.

5. Seasonal and Recurring Content

  • Plan and curate content for seasonal topics or recurring events—this could be holidays, annual industry conferences, or seasonal trends.
  • For instance, during the holiday season, create a Moment that features special offers, celebrations within your team, or customer testimonials reflecting the joy of the season.

6. Curate By Themes or Topics

  • If your brand centers around specific topics or themes, create Moments that consolidate diverse discussions, articles, or opinions on those subjects.
  • Examples could include a Moment focusing on diversity in the workplace, environmental sustainability, or technological advancements in your industry.

7. Engage with Influencers and Experts

  • Collaborate with industry influencers and thought leaders by featuring their tweets in your Moments. With their permission, highlighting a conversation can provide additional credibility while engaging a broader audience.
  • Consider reaching out to these individuals ahead of time, seeking their permission to feature their insights or asking if they want to contribute content for a specific Moment.

Measuring Success and Impact

After creating and sharing Twitter Moments, evaluating their impact is critical. Here are ways to measure success:

1. Analytics

  • Twitter provides engagement metrics for Moments, including views, interactions, and shares. Analyze these metrics to understand how well your content resonated with your audience.
  • Determine which types of Moments attracted the most engagement and apply those insights to improve future Moments.

2. Follower Feedback

  • Encourage followers to provide feedback about the Moments you create. Polls and questionnaires can help you understand what resonated most and how you can improve your content strategy moving forward.
  • Monitor mentions of your Moments within conversations. Engaging with your audience can lead to valuable insights and foster rapport.

3. Look for Trends

  • Keep an eye on the effectiveness of recurring themes or strategies. If certain types of content consistently generate high engagement, consider making them a regular part of your content strategy.
